Ogun PDP Berates Bankole For Dropping Jonathan, Mu’azu’s Names

Ahead of the
2015 general elections, the Forum of
Local Government Chairmen in Ogun
State chapter of the Peoples Democratic
Party (PDP), has cautioned aspirants
and their sponsors against name-
dropping.
The warning came on the heels of
reports that Chief Alani Bankole, the
father of former Speaker of the House
of Representatives, Hon. Dimeji Bankole,
stormed a recent meeting of the forum
and boasted that his son has been
assured the state PDP’s governorship
ticket by President Goodluck Jonathan
and Alhaji Ahmadu Adamu Mu’azu, the
national chairman of the party.
In a statement yesterday by the
Chairman of PDP in Abeokuta South
Local Government and Chairman of the
Forum, Hon. Kehinde Sofenwa, the group
said: “The elder Bankole’s conduct is
unbecoming of an elder and a
democrat. We urge him and his son to
follow the due process and not seek to
usurp constituted authority.
“We know that the decision to drop the
name of the President and the national
chairman is one of the many lies that
the Bankoles are telling in order to
hoodwink unsuspecting members of the
party. But we remain undeterred and
urge our members across the state to
remain firm.
“We recall that some months back, they
were going about to say that the
President and the National Chairman
had assured them that the authentic
and legally constituted State Exco of our
party would be dissolved. But till date,
nothing of such has happened. Rather,
the party, under the leadership of our
able Chairman, Engr. Adebayo Dayo, is
waxing stronger.
“Much as we shudder to think if it is the
younger Bankole that is in the race or
the father, we wish to state without
mincing words that all these lies are
unfounded”.
